Pre-Purchase Inspection Checklist for 2024 Dodge Durango

Before purchasing a used 2024 Dodge Durango, perform the following targeted inspections based on reported federal defect patterns:

1. Cold Start & Idle Diagnostics

Scan the OBD-II port under the dash for pending freeze-frame codes (e.g. P0300 misfires, P0087 fuel rail pressure, P0420 catalytic efficiency).

2. Transmission Shift Quality Audit

Test vehicle at low-speed stop-and-go and highway merges. Check for delayed reverse engagement or gear shift shudder between 2nd and 3rd gears.
